Frequently asked questions
What types of unique stays are available in Arkansas?
Arkansas offers treehouses, geodesic domes, converted barns, houseboats, and architecturally distinctive cabins. Our Arkansas collection includes verified listings across Airbnb, VRBO, and Wander, each reviewed for the kind of setting that makes a trip memorable.
How much do unique rentals in Arkansas cost?
Prices for unique stays in Arkansas typically range from $75 to $500+ per night depending on the property type, season, and amenities. Treehouses and domes tend to book out early in peak season — reserve well ahead if you're planning a summer or holiday trip.
